Does anyone work for a cash based Outpatient PT practice? by AssistantLiving9978 in physicaltherapy

[–]Adventure_key 1 point2 points  (0 children)

My boss provides health insurance and 401K match. I had PTO when I was 32 hours or more, but dropped down to find a better balance. Definitely have to budget when wanting to take time off and knowing my paychecks will fluctuate throughout the year. I'd say that's the main difficult transition (especially when I was getting started as I was new to OP and pelvic and cash-based so there was a huge learning curve) but I had other PRN jobs to pad my income in my first year at this job. Other than that, now that I'm more settled, I love the flexibility and I'm lucky to have a cool boss who prioritizes work-life balance.

Does anyone work for a cash based Outpatient PT practice? by AssistantLiving9978 in physicaltherapy

[–]Adventure_key 4 points5 points  (0 children)

OP cash based pelvic health, 1:1 75 evals, 60 treats; I currently only work part-time at 26ish hours per week, about 4-7 patients a day. IMO 30 min is way too short for pelvic, most in-network places will typically at least do 45’s, so would definitely ask about that if considering this job! We get 30 min doc time daily, but I typically have a gap somewhere in my week to finish notes as needed.
